11:02 steam users enraged over Intel exclusive
11:06 content in game inspiring quick
11:11 reversal and it's more than just there was some content in the game that was
11:17 exclusive to Intel users it was actually
11:20 exclusive to Intel Core i7 users so uh
11:26 here we go the developers of Arizona sunshine for the HTC VI and the
11:30 controversy began over two pieces of content in game
11:35 um okay so the controversy over the two pieces of content began with a post on
11:39 the game team page asking why one machine the player owned could play The
11:43 Horde mode in single player and the other could not so the developer
11:49 explained that The Horde setting and apocalyptic mode were locked to machines
11:53 running core i7s until March of next
11:57 year we're talking a thre Monon
12:00 exclusivity period for buying a core i7

19:21 so South Korea has effectively uh made
19:24 game modding illegal uh so they've passed an amendment into law with with
19:28 the intent of shutting down video game hacks and modifications and based on the
19:32 law manufacture or distribution of
19:35 programs that are not allowed by a game company or its terms of service or
19:40 actually against the law so this includes aim boders hacking programs
19:44 scriptors basically anything that's not allowed by the terms of service um the
19:49 punishment for this is actually is is theoretically pretty steep uh 5 years of
19:53 jail time or the equivalent of $43,000 in fines um part of this is in
20:00 response to um hacking communities for certain games particularly OverWatch um
20:03 hacking is run rampant with OverWatch in South Korea uh so blizzard has been
20:08 trying to take its own action against players that are doing the hacks but now
20:12 with this they're also going to have the full vacing of the South Korean
20:15 government so thoughts on

28:01 getting back to our getting back to our Watchdog story here in mid November a
28:06 French Finance regulator has accused had accused five Ubisoft Executives of
28:10 insider trading back in 2014 including the head of Ubisoft Montreal so
28:17 theor de fin handed down the fine ear
28:22 today Ubisoft has told Kotaku that the publisher will be appealing the judgment
28:28 they believe those involved didn't intentionally commit any crime so the
28:32 AMF is specifically accusing those execs of having prior knowledge of the
28:36 watchdog's delay and then taking advantage of that privileged information
28:40 to sell their shares before the value dropped I sure as hell would have sold
28:44 my shares before Watch Dogs came out oh
28:47 good lord I'm glad I don't didn't own any Ubisoft shares and I didn't know it
28:50 was going to be delayed and it was going to be a terrible Port because uh yeah
28:54 then I could be in trouble right now so the delay announcement caused Ubisoft
28:57 shares to dropped 25% in value back in
29:00 2014 Ubisoft is arguing that due to the processes and timetables involved in
29:04 game development those involved couldn't have known about the delay at the time
29:08 that they sold shares which to which I would say okay

51:17 closer to where it needs to be so this is not the first time that Microsoft has
51:24 been capable of running Windows was on an ARM-based machine in fact um those of
51:29 you who were around when it happened the
51:33 Surface RT was an ARM powerered Windows
51:37 Microsoft Surface tablet it was or two
51:41 in one technically I guess but it it was not a great experience it was a it
51:46 wasn't it was just called Windows RT like it wasn't Surface RT well yeah but
51:50 it was it wasn't a direct oh the OS was Windows RT yeah that's what I said so so
51:56 yeah yeah yeah no no I was sorry I was talking about Surface RT running Windows
52:00 RT Windows RT which I they but they had to change I think the code base because
52:04 it was ARM is that right or uh so yeah so basically it was based on Windows 8
52:09 but it could run on ARM and they ported Microsoft Office and in fact they
52:14 couldn't even sell surface RTS with an included copy of Microsoft Office like
52:19 not a trial like they actually included the full office suite that you could use
52:23 on it and it still wasn't enough to make people
52:27 get into it because it couldn't run
52:30 regular x86 applications meaning why am
52:34 I running Windows at all you're just limited to like maybe some things you
52:38 could find in the Windows store and a few other things so this is new
52:41 Microsoft demo Photoshop running on a
52:44 Snapdragon 820 very freaking cool so this was at
52:48 the win HC Hardware conference in shenzen and they announced a range of
52:52 hardwar driven initiatives to modernize the PC and address two big goals
52:57 expanded support for mixed reality and to produce a range of ever more
53:00 efficient mobile always connected PCS powered by ARM processors so qualcom
53:06 powered Windows 10 um PCS will hit the market in 2017
53:11 with a full Desktop Windows 10 variant coming to ARM there will be a 64-bit
53:16 version running on qualcomm's latest and greatest processors so presumably the
53:20 Snapdragon 835 and the way that Microsoft describes it it will offer a
53:25 full Windows Experience with the ability to run not only universal Windows
53:29 platform apps from the store but regular win32 desktop applications it'll include
53:34 built-in emulation for 32-bit x86
53:38 applications and the emulation will be used only for application code the OS
53:42 itself itself and all system libraries will be native 64-bit ARM binaries
53:47 pretty freaking cool so actually no I had misunderstood an earlier part of the
